Frequently Asked Questions about vacation rentals in Gainesville, FL

  • What should a first-time visitor not miss in Gainesville, FL?

    You definitely want to visit the University of Florida campus, especially the historic buildings like the President's House and the Century Tower. And don't miss the Florida Museum of Natural History, it's got some fantastic exhibits.

  • What are the top family-friendly attractions in Gainesville, FL?

    The Butterfly Rainforest at the Florida Museum of Natural History is a big hit with kids, they love seeing all the butterflies flying around. Another great option is the Cade Museum for Creativity and Invention, it's a fun and interactive museum that encourages kids to think outside the box.

  • What events or festivals should visitors check out in and around Gainesville, FL?

    The annual Swamp Stomp Festival in October is a popular event with live music, food stalls, and arts and crafts. If you're visiting in spring, check out the Gainesville Arts Festival, it's a great opportunity to see local artists and buy unique crafts.

  • What are the best budget-friendly activities in Gainesville, FL?

    Gainesville has plenty of free and low-cost activities. Take a walk or cycle along the scenic Gainesville-Hawthorne State Trail, it's a great way to enjoy the outdoors without spending a penny. You can also visit the University of Florida campus, it's a beautiful place to explore and there are plenty of free events happening throughout the year.

  • What are the best walking or cycling routes in Gainesville, FL?

    The Gainesville Hawthorne State Trail is a great option for a leisurely bike ride, and the Alachua Sink Trail is a beautiful walk through the woods. You can also check out the University of Florida campus, it's got lots of walking paths.

  • What are the top sports attractions and facilities in Gainesville, FL?

    The University of Florida is a big draw for sports fans, with Ben Hill Griffin Stadium hosting the Gators football team. The O'Connell Center is also home to the Gators basketball and volleyball teams.
